Decentralized Exchange Data Synchronization
Decentralized exchange data synchronization refers to the process of ensuring that price information across multiple decentralized exchanges remains consistent and reflects the true market value. Because these exchanges operate independently, prices can drift apart, creating opportunities for arbitrage.
Synchronization is achieved through cross-chain oracles or aggregation layers that monitor multiple sources and provide a unified price feed. This is essential for maintaining a fair trading environment and preventing fragmentation.
When synchronization fails, it can lead to massive price discrepancies that disrupt derivative markets and trigger incorrect liquidations. Developers use various techniques to achieve synchronization, including state proofs and relayers.
The goal is to provide a reliable, single source of truth for all protocols in the ecosystem. This process is central to the development of interoperable financial applications.
